    Guidant Corporation, part of Boston Scientific and Abbott Labs, designs and manufactures artificial cardiac pacemakers, implantable cardioverter-defibrillators, stents, and other cardiovascular medical products. Their company headquarters is located in Indianapolis, Indiana.

    The company was named after Jude the Apostle, the patron saint of lost causes. [4] St. Jude Medical was founded in 1976 and went public in 1977, [4] [5] and the company has been listed in the Fortune 500 every year since 2010. [6] The company was acquired by Abbott Laboratories in January 2017. [7] [8]

    Abbott Laboratories is an American multinational medical devices and health care company with headquarters in Abbott Park, Illinois, in the United States. The company was founded by Chicago physician Wallace Calvin Abbott in 1888 to formulate known drugs; today, it sells medical devices, diagnostics, branded generic medicines and nutritional products.
